How Power Outages Are Fueling the Growth of the Home Energy Storage Market in America
In recent years, power outages have become a disruptive and even dangerous part of life for many American households. From California’s wildfires to Texas’s deep freezes, millions of families have faced sudden blackouts—interrupting daily routines, threatening safety, and heightening anxiety. These frequent disruptions, driven by aging infrastructure and climate-related extremes, are sparking a shift in how people think about electricity at home. At the center of this shift is the home energy storage market, which is rapidly expanding as demand for reliable and independent power solutions grows.
A Grid Under Pressure: The Weather-Power Connection
According to the U.S. Census Bureau, nearly 25% of U.S. households experienced at least one power outage in the past year, with 70% of those outages lasting more than six hours. These events are more than just inconvenient—they can be life-threatening, especially for residents dependent on powered medical equipment.
Source: U.S. Census Bureau, 2023 Household Pulse Survey
Looking ahead, winter 2025 in Texas is forecast to bring heavy snowfall and prolonged cold temperatures, echoing the devastating storm that overwhelmed the state’s grid in 2021. Prolonged outages could once again leave families in the dark—literally and figuratively.
Source: The Old Farmer’s Almanac, 2025 Winter Outlook
When the Lights Go Out: What Households Without Storage Face
Households lacking backup storage face a range of risks during blackouts:
- Refrigerated medications and food can spoil quickly.
- Homes lose access to heating or cooling systems, raising health concerns.
- Internet and communication systems go offline, affecting work, education, and safety.
- Security systems fail, increasing vulnerability.
- Families relying on powered medical equipment may face emergencies.
While emergency kits and neighborhood support plans offer temporary relief, they rarely deliver long-term resilience. The rise in outages is highlighting just how essential uninterrupted power has become in modern life.
The Role of Energy Storage in a Resilient Home
Home energy storage systems offer a robust solution to these challenges. They act as both emergency power sources and everyday energy management tools. When integrated with solar panels, they allow homes to store energy during the day and draw from it when needed—reducing reliance on the grid and lowering utility bills.
The true value of these systems becomes clear in common scenarios:
- Health protection: Supporting CPAP machines, oxygen concentrators, or insulin storage.
- Comfort and continuity: Keeping heating and cooling systems online during extreme weather.
- Work and learning: Maintaining access to remote tools and communications.
- Food and medicine safety: Preventing spoilage in prolonged outages.
- Security: Ensuring surveillance and smart locks remain functional.
With rising awareness and improving battery technologies, more households are seeing home energy storage not as a luxury, but as a necessity.
The Home Energy Storage Market: Momentum and Opportunity
Driven by growing need, technological advances, and government support, the home energy storage market is experiencing rapid growth across the United States—especially in outage-prone regions like California, Texas, Florida, and Puerto Rico.
Federal incentives such as the 30% Investment Tax Credit (ITC) for battery systems, coupled with state-level rebates and financing programs, are making these systems more affordable.
Source: U.S. Department of Energy, 2024 Clean Energy Incentives
According to Wood Mackenzie, the U.S. residential energy storage market is expected to quadruple between 2023 and 2030, with the home segment driving a significant share of that expansion.
Source: Wood Mackenzie, U.S. Energy Storage Monitor, Q1 2024
As adoption increases, the home energy storage market is evolving into a strategic pillar of the country’s broader energy transition—contributing not only to household resilience but also to grid flexibility through programs like virtual power plants (VPPs).
Looking Ahead: Beyond Backup
While backup power remains the most immediate benefit, modern energy storage systems represent a much bigger shift. These systems give households greater control over their electricity use, reduce peak-time grid stress, and enable participation in broader energy-sharing ecosystems.
As technologies improve and costs decline, storage is increasingly viewed as a cornerstone of smart, sustainable living.
